The internet cafe that I used:

Net@vision
10 rue Git-Le-Coeur 75006
Metro: St-Michel
Open: 10am to 8pm day days a week.

0.05€/min
Minimum: 1.50€/30 minutes

I found it walking from Blvd. St. Michele onto rue Saint Andres des Arts. Rue git-Le-Coeur is a right hand turn off des Arts, just one block.
